Hi Francis, Yes, screenshot below. Now, it does come up where we have to "Enable Editing", but, no save or open. We also use an ASNAME to give it a viable report title, kinda:
TABLE FILE CAR
ON TABLE SET PAGE-NUM OFF
SUM RC AND DC AND
COMPUTE PROFIT/P12.6 = (RC - DC) * .43567;
BY CAR
HEADING
"Profit By Car"
" "
ON TABLE COLUMN-TOTAL
ON TABLE PCHOLD AS 'Car_Report' FORMAT XLSX
ON TABLE SET STYLE *
TYPE=REPORT, COLOR=BLUE, BACKCOLOR=SILVER, SIZE=9,$
TYPE=HEADING, STYLE=BOLD, SIZE=14, $
TYPE=TITLE, STYLE=BOLD, SIZE=11,$
TYPE=GRANDTOTAL, STYLE=BOLD, SIZE=11,$
ENDSTYLE
END
-EXIT
This doesn't appear to work in WF8.0.08 and IE11. I set all Excel related extensions to yes, yes, cleared the cache, restarted Tomcat, but I get the same result - a popup at the bottom of the IE11 page:
